Product Detailed Parameters

  • Description:IC RFID READER 13.56MHZ 32VQFN
  • Series:-
  • Mfr:Texas Instruments
  • Package:Tape & Reel (TR),Cut Tape (CT),Bulk
  • Type:RFID Reader
  • Frequency:13.56MHz
  • Standards:ISO 14443, ISO 15693, ISO 18000-3
  • Interface:SPI
  • Voltage - Supply:2.7V ~ 5.5V
  • Operating Temperature:-40°C ~ 110°C
  • Mounting Type:Surface Mount
  • Package / Case:32-VFQFN Exposed Pad
  • Supplier Device Package:32-VQFN (5x5)
  • Grade:-
  • Qualification:-
